Man dies in Vermilion Township house fire

VERMILION TOWNSHIP , Ohio (WJW) – A man died after a house fire in Vermilion Township on Thursday morning.

According to Vermilion Township Fire Department Chief Frank Triana, fire crews were called to a house on the 14000 block of Darrow Road just before 7 a.m.

Fire crews arrived at the scene shortly after and found a home fully engulfed in flames, with fire coming through the roof, according to Triana.

The cause of the fire is still under investigation but it “does not appear to be suspicious at this time,” according to Triana.

According to the Ohio State Fire Marshal’s Office, the man who died lived at the home. No other information has yet been released about the victim at this time…
